VTEC stands for Variable Valve Timing and Lift Electronic Control. It allows the engine to switch between different cam profiles, delivering improved high-end power without sacrificing low-end torque or fuel efficiency. In the Prelude, the VTEC-equipped H22A offered a broader power band and more spirited performance than its non-VTEC predecessors.

Did the Honda Prelude have VTEC?


Similar to the systems on the Acura NSX and Integra GS-R, the Prelude VTEC system uses two sets of cam lobes to blur the usual compromises between high-speed cylinder filling and low-speed tractability.
